WebLight represents innocence, truth and purity while darkness is used to represent cruelty, guilt and corruption. Towards the end of the play, Shakespeare correlates the ideas of both lightness and darkness to portray life and death. Ultimately, they represent good and evil.

A source of light makes light. The Sun and other stars, fires, torches and lamps all make their own light and so are examples of sources of light.
